Murmur  [author] Feb 24, 2021 @ 4:32pm 
That will work great if a mod adds harvestable bodyparts that inherit from "BodyPartNaturalBase". They all probably do, but I didn't feel like looking into it and decided to make something that doesn't assume the inheritance. Your method is probably 100% sufficient. Mine is just overengineered because I felt like it lol.
Flash2 Feb 24, 2021 @ 9:01am 
May I ask, why you do this with an assembly and not just with a xpath patch? I have done the same with a patch for myself. Now I am not sure if this is "better". For Reference, I have done this:

<Operation Class="PatchOperationSequence">
<success>Always</success>
<operations>
<li Class="PatchOperationAdd">
<xpath>Defs/ThingDef[@Name="BodyPartNaturalBase"]</xpath>
<value>
<tickerType>Rare</tickerType>
</value>
</li>
<li Class="PatchOperationAdd">
<xpath>Defs/ThingDef[@Name="BodyPartNaturalBase"]</xpath>
<value>
<comps>
<li Class="CompProperties_Rottable">
<daysToRotStart>0.6</daysToRotStart>
<rotDestroys>true</rotDestroys>
</li>
</comps>
</value>
</li>
</operations>
</Operation>
